74ALVC162240T Equivalent & Substitute Parts

Part Overview

The 74ALVC162240T is a buffer inverting logic IC manufactured by onsemi, designed for 3.6V operation with 4 elements and 4 bits per element configuration. This component features 3-state output capability and is housed in a 48-TSSOP package. The product is currently obsolete, making equivalent substitute parts necessary for ongoing system support and new design implementations where compatible alternatives are required.

Substitute Part Grouping Explanation

Substitute parts for the 74ALVC162240T are qualified based on the following electrical and mechanical parameters:

Core Compatibility Criteria:

  • Logic type: Buffer, Inverting
  • Number of elements: 4
  • Number of bits per element: 4
  • Output type: 3-State
  • Supply voltage range: 1.65V ~ 3.6V
  • Operating temperature range: -40°C ~ 85°C (TA)
  • Package type: 48-pin TSSOP/SSOP family
  • Mounting type: Surface Mount

Allowed Parameter Variations:

  • Output current capability may exceed the original specification (higher current is acceptable)
  • Packaging format within the 48-pin TSSOP/SSOP family is acceptable
  • Manufacturer may differ
  • Product status may differ (Active status preferred for new designs)

The identified substitute parts maintain functional equivalence through identical logic configuration, voltage specifications, and thermal operating range while offering improved availability and active product status.

Engineering Selection Recommendations

SN74ALVCH16240DGGR (Texas Instruments) is the primary substitute for the 74ALVC162240T. This part maintains identical package dimensions (48-TFSOP, 0.240" width), electrical specifications, and thermal operating range. The device carries Active product status and ROHS3 compliance, providing long-term availability and regulatory alignment. Output current capability is doubled (24mA vs. 12mA), which is acceptable for applications designed around the original specification.

SN74ALVCH16240DL (Texas Instruments) is an alternative substitute with identical electrical and thermal characteristics. This variant uses a wider package format (48-BSSOP, 0.295" width) and is supplied in tube packaging rather than tape & reel. Selection of this part requires PCB layout accommodation for the increased package width. Active product status and ROHS3 compliance are maintained.

Both Texas Instruments alternatives provide superior long-term support compared to the obsolete onsemi part, with higher output current capability suitable for demanding applications.

Frequently Asked Questions (FAQ)

Q: Can SN74ALVCH16240DGGR directly replace 74ALVC162240T without PCB modification?

A: Yes. Both parts use the 48-TFSOP package with identical 0.240" (6.10mm) width and pin configuration. Direct PCB substitution is possible without layout changes.

Q: What is the difference between SN74ALVCH16240DGGR and SN74ALVCH16240DL?

A: The primary difference is package format. SN74ALVCH16240DGGR uses 48-TFSOP (0.240" width) in tape & reel packaging, while SN74ALVCH16240DL uses 48-BSSOP (0.295" width) in tube packaging. Electrical specifications are identical. PCB layout must accommodate the wider BSSOP package for the DL variant.

Q: Why do the Texas Instruments substitutes have higher output current (24mA vs. 12mA)?

A: The SN74ALVCH series is a higher-performance variant of the 74ALVC series. Increased output current capability is a design improvement that maintains backward compatibility while providing enhanced drive capability for applications requiring higher current delivery.

Q: Are the substitute parts RoHS compliant?

A: Yes. Both Texas Instruments substitutes (SN74ALVCH16240DGGR and SN74ALVCH16240DL) are ROHS3 compliant. The original onsemi part RoHS status is not specified in the available data.

Q: What is the moisture sensitivity level for these parts?

A: All three parts (original and substitutes) have MSL 1 (Unlimited), indicating no moisture sensitivity restrictions during storage or handling.

Q: Can I use these parts interchangeably in my existing designs?

A: SN74ALVCH16240DGGR is a direct pin-for-pin replacement with identical package dimensions. SN74ALVCH16240DL requires PCB layout verification due to the wider package format. Both maintain identical electrical and thermal specifications, making them functionally equivalent for the specified operating conditions.
